Goderich Tornado Hit On This Day In 2011

Tuesday is the seventh anniversary of the F3 tornado that tore into Goderich from Lake Huron, leaving one person dead and 37 injured.

The twister hit on a Sunday at 3:53pm and moved from the harbour, up the lake bank and east-southeast through town.

In just two minutes, it left a 1.5 km wide path of destruction, causing $100-million in damage.
